brain stroke - Spanish English Dictionary
History

brain stroke

Play ENESENus
Play ENESENuk
Play ENESENau


Meanings of "brain stroke" in Spanish English Dictionary : 2 result(s)

English Spanish
Engineering
brain stroke derrame /embolia cerebral
Medicine
brain stroke derrame cerebral